Nobody Hates the Brotherly Shove More than Serial Complainer Joe Schad

Joe Schad used to be with ESPN and now covers the Miami Dolphins for the Palm Beach Post. He hates the Brotherly Shove like nobody has hated anything before (paraphrasing) –

Five tush push tweets. The Eagles were 4-4 on the evening and converted the shove with 100% accuracy. They also converted on the one that was flagged for offsetting penalties, so we’ll round up and say they actually went 5-5. That’s one tush push conversion for every Joe Schad whiner tweet. A perfect ratio!
